Word Study · Strong's H5145 · Hebrew
נֶזֶר
nezer
neh'-zer
“properly, something set apart, i.e. (abstractly) dedication (of a priet or Nazirite)”
Strong's Dictionary · 1890 · public domain
properly, something set apart, i.e. (abstractly) dedication (of a priet or Nazirite); hence (concretely) unshorn locks; also (by implication) a chaplet (especially of royalty)
Rendered in the KJV as
consecration, crown, hair, separation.
